You have a project to build. You open your laptop, search for the best web framework 2026, and immediately hit a wall of conflicting opinions: React vs Vue, Django vs Flask, Node vs Ruby on Rails. Every developer online seems to have a different strong opinion, and none of it tells you what actually matters for your specific situation.
Choosing the wrong framework does not just slow down development, it creates technical debt that compounds for years. The right framework, on the other hand, cuts build time significantly, makes onboarding new developers faster, and scales cleanly as your product grows. This guide cuts through the noise and gives you exactly what you need: a clear breakdown of the 18 best Web Development Frameworks List for 2026, what each one is built for, and how to choose without second-guessing yourself.
What Are Web Development Frameworks?
A web development framework is a pre-built collection of code, tools, and conventions that gives developers a structured starting point for building web applications. Instead of writing everything from scratch routing, authentication, database connections, security handling. a framework provides tested, reusable components that handle the common parts of every project.
Think of it like building a house. You could manufacture every brick, beam, and fitting yourself. You could start with a foundation and prefabricated structure, then focus your energy on the parts that make this house unique. Frameworks are that foundation for web applications.
A startup building a customer dashboard in React can move from idea to working prototype in days rather than weeks. A team using Django for a data-heavy back-end ships features faster because authentication, database management, and admin panels come built in. Many developers struggle with picking frameworks that scale with business growth. But understanding what each framework is optimized for makes that decision far more straightforward.
Key Features to Look For
Performance and speed
A framework’s performance directly affects your users’ experience and your search rankings. Look for frameworks with efficient rendering, minimal overhead, and proven performance benchmarks at the scale you expect to reach.
Scalability
A framework that works for a 500-user app may buckle under 500,000 users. Choose based on your expected growth trajectory, not just your current needs. Frameworks like Next.js and Django have proven they scale to enterprise level.
Community support and documentation
From a practical perspective, small teams benefit most from frameworks with strong documentation and active communities. When you hit a problem at 11pm before a deadline, Stack Overflow answers and maintained GitHub issues are what save the project.
Security
Good frameworks handle common vulnerabilities, SQL injection, cross-site scripting, CSRF attacks out of the box. Avoid frameworks that require you to implement security from scratch unless your team has dedicated security expertise.
Open-source vs. commercial
Most production-grade frameworks are open-source, meaning free to use and community-maintained. Commercial frameworks sometimes offer better support contracts relevant for enterprise teams with compliance requirements.
AI tooling integration
In 2026, the best development environments integrate with AI coding assistants like GitHub Copilot and Cursor. Frameworks with strong TypeScript support and clear conventions tend to get better AI suggestions. Because the code patterns are well-represented in training data.

Top 18 Web Development Frameworks for 2026
Front-end frameworks
1. React
The most widely used front-end library in the world. React’s component-based architecture makes building complex, interactive UIs manageable. Its enormous ecosystem Next.js, React Query, Zustand means almost every problem you will encounter already has a well-maintained solution.
2. Vue.js
Gentler learning curve than React, with excellent documentation and a clean, readable syntax. Vue is often the first choice for teams transitioning from jQuery or for projects where developer onboarding speed matters as much as raw capability.
3. Angular
A full-featured front-end framework with built-in solutions for routing, state management, forms, and HTTP requests. Opinionated by design which reduces decision fatigue on large enterprise teams where consistency across hundreds of files matters more than flexibility.
4. Svelte
Compiles your components to pure JavaScript at build time, no virtual DOM overhead at runtime. Results in faster load times and smaller bundle sizes than React or Vue. Growing fast in 2026, particularly for performance-critical applications.
5. Astro
Built for content-heavy sites and blogs where page speed is critical. Astro ships zero JavaScript by default only loading interactivity where explicitly needed. Ideal for marketing sites, documentation, and anything where Core Web Vitals scores directly affect rankings.
Back-end frameworks
6. Django
A batteries-included Python framework with a built-in admin panel, ORM, authentication system, and security features. Reduces back-end development time dramatically for data-heavy applications. Widely used in fintech, healthcare, and media industries where reliability and security matter most.
7. Flask
A minimal Python framework that gives you only what you need and nothing more. Best for APIs, microservices, and projects where you want full control over architecture without the opinions that come with Django. Pairs naturally with AI and machine learning workflows because of Python’s data science ecosystem.
8. Express.js
The most popular Node.js framework by a wide margin. Minimal, fast, and flexible. It handles routing and middleware and leaves everything else to you. Best for developers who want to build a custom back-end without framework constraints, or who need a lightweight API layer behind a React or Vue front-end.
9. FastAPI
A modern Python framework built specifically for APIs, with automatic documentation generation, native async support, and type validation built in. In 2026 it is the go-to choice for teams building AI-powered back-ends and data-heavy APIs because it is fast, type-safe, and integrates naturally with Python’s ML libraries.
10. Ruby on Rails
Convention over configuration Rails makes decisions for you so your team spends time building features rather than debating architecture. Still powering some of the web’s largest applications in 2026, including Shopify. Best for early-stage startups that need to move fast and iterate aggressively.
11. Laravel
The leading PHP framework has elegant syntax, a mature ecosystem, and first-class tools for authentication, queues, caching, and real-time events. PHP powers a large percentage of the web’s CMS infrastructure, making Laravel a natural choice for agencies building client sites on top of existing PHP hosting environments.
12. Spring Boot
The dominant Java framework for enterprise back-end development. Strong typing, mature tooling, and deep integration with corporate infrastructure make it the standard in banking, insurance, and large-scale enterprise applications where Java expertise is already established on the team.
Full-stack frameworks
13. Next.js
The most popular full-stack React framework in 2026. Handles server-side rendering, static generation, API routes, and edge functions in a single project. Its App Router architecture and React Server Components model make it the default choice for production React applications that need both performance and SEO.
14. Nuxt.js
Does for Vue what Next.js does for React server-side rendering, file-based routing, and a full-stack deployment model in one framework. A natural upgrade path for Vue.js projects that need production-grade performance and SEO without switching to a different front-end library.
15. SvelteKit
The official full-stack framework for Svelte. Combines Svelte’s minimal runtime with server-side rendering and a flexible deployment model. Growing adoption in 2026 among teams that prioritize performance metrics and want a modern alternative to the React ecosystem.
16. Remix
A React framework focused on web fundamentals, progressive enhancement, nested routing, and server-side data loading that works without JavaScript. Particularly strong for applications where accessibility and resilience on slow connections matter.
AI-assisted and emerging frameworks
17. tRPC
Not a full framework but increasingly essential in modern full-stack TypeScript projects. tRPC creates end-to-end type-safe APIs between your Next.js front-end and back-end without writing any schema files. AI coding assistants generate dramatically better suggestions in tRPC codebases because the type information gives them complete context about your data structures.
18. Hono
A lightweight, ultra-fast web framework built for edge computing environments, Cloudflare Workers, Deno Deploy, and similar platforms. In 2026 it is gaining significant traction as teams move API logic closer to users for lower latency, with AI tooling integrations that make edge deployment dramatically simpler than it was two years ago.
How Frameworks Improve Development Efficiency
Without a framework, a developer building a standard web application writes authentication from scratch, sets up their own routing logic, manually manages database connections, and implements security protections independently. Each of these tasks takes days. Each introduces potential errors. And none of them create competitive advantage, they solve problems.
Frameworks eliminate that overhead. A Django project has a working authentication system in the afternoon. A Next.js project has server-side rendering and API routes configured before lunch. This compounds time saving across every standard feature of a web application. That is why teams using frameworks consistently ship faster than those building from scratch.
A practical workflow, a two-person startup team uses Next.js for the front-end and API layer, Fast API for the data processing back-end, and Vercel for deployment. They launch a working MVP in three weeks. The same application built without frameworks would take three months minimum and carry significantly more technical risk.

AI-Powered Web Development in 2026
AI coding assistants GitHub Copilot, Cursor, and Claude have become genuine productivity multipliers for framework-based development. They generate boilerplate, suggest completions based on your project’s conventions, catch common errors before they reach production, and explain unfamiliar framework patterns in plain language.
Frameworks with strong TypeScript support (Next.js, Angular, tRPC, SvelteKit) benefit most from AI assistance because the type system gives AI tools complete information about data structures and function signatures. Producing suggestions that are accurate rather than plausible-sounding guesses. AI-assisted frameworks should augment human coding skills, not replace them. A developer who understands what their framework is doing will always use AI suggestions more effectively than one who accepts every suggestion without understanding the output.
How to Choose the Right Framework
Building a content or marketing site?
Use Astro for maximum performance, or Next.js if you need interactivity alongside content. Both are built for fast load times and strong SEO which directly affects organic traffic.
How to Choose the Right Web Development Framework?
React with Next.js is the safest choice, largest ecosystem, most hiring pool, best AI tooling support. Vue with Nuxt is a strong alternative if your team already knows Vue.
Building a data-heavy API or AI back-end?
FastAPI for modern Python projects, Django for teams that want everything built in, Express for Node.js teams who prefer minimal conventions.
Building for enterprise or regulated industries?
Angular for front-end (strong typing, opinionated structure), Spring Boot for Java back-ends, Django for Python teams with compliance requirements.
Early-stage startup moving fast?
Ruby on Rails or Next.js both optimize for development speed and iteration velocity over architectural purity.
Combining Frameworks Effectively
Most production applications use more than one framework. A front-end framework handling the UI, a back-end framework managing data and business logic, and increasingly an edge layer handling routing and performance optimization. A clean, proven combination for 2026:
Front-end
Next.js handles the React UI, server-side rendering, and public-facing API routes.
Back-end
FastAPI manages data processing, ML model serving, and internal business logic, connected to Next.js via REST or tRPC.
Database
Prisma ORM provides type-safe database access that works with both Next.js and FastAPI, reducing integration friction between layers.
AI tooling
GitHub Copilot or Cursor works across the full stack, generating consistent suggestions because TypeScript types define the data contracts between layers.
Deployment
Vercel for Next.js, Railway or Render for FastAPI both with zero-config CI/CD that reduces deployment overhead to near zero.
Common Mistakes to Avoid
Choosing based on popularity alone
React is the most popular front-end framework but if you are building a mostly static content site, Astro will outperform it significantly. Match the framework to the project, not the GitHub star count.
Ignoring scalability until it becomes a crisis
A framework that works perfectly at launch can become a bottleneck at scale. Evaluate whether your chosen framework has a track record at the user volume you expect to reach in two to three years, not just today.
Overcomplicating small projects
A personal portfolio site does not need Next.js with a FastAPI back-end and a tRPC API layer. Over-engineering creates a maintenance burden without delivering value. Match complexity to actual requirements.
Ignoring community and ecosystem health
A framework with poor documentation, inactive maintainers, or a shrinking community becomes a liability over time. Check GitHub activity, npm download trends, and Stack Overflow question volume before committing to anything unfamiliar.
Switching frameworks mid-project without a clear reason
Framework switching is expensive, it rewrites architecture, retrains the team, and introduces regression risk. Evaluate frameworks thoroughly before starting. Changing direction because a new option looks interesting rarely ends well.
Final Thoughts
Choosing a web development framework is one of the highest-leverage decisions in any project. The right choice reduces build time, standardizes your codebase, and scales with your product. The wrong choice creates compounding technical debt that becomes harder to unwind the longer you leave it. Use this guide as a starting point, match the framework to your project type, validate it against your team’s existing skills, and confirm the community is active before committing. Most successful production applications in 2026 combine two or three frameworks, Best Web Development Frameworks list a modern front-end, a focused back-end, and AI tooling woven throughout the development workflow. Start with the right foundation and build from there.
FAQs
Q1. What are the best web development frameworks for beginners?
Start with React for front-end, it has the largest learning resource ecosystem, the most job postings, and the best AI coding assistant support. Pair it with Next.js once you are comfortable with React basics. For back-end beginners, Django is the strongest starting point, its documentation is exceptional and its built-in tools handle the complexity that trips up new developers.
Q2. Should I use a front-end, back-end, or full-stack framework?
It depends on your project. If you are building a UI-heavy web app that connects to an existing API, a front-end framework like React or Vue is sufficient. If you are building an API or data-driven service with no front-end, a back-end framework like FastAPI or Express is the right tool. If you are building a complete product from scratch with a small team, a full-stack framework like Next.js or Rails reduces the coordination overhead between layers significantly.
Q3. Are free web development frameworks reliable for production?
Yes. Virtually every framework on this list is open-source and free to use, including those powering some of the world’s largest applications. React is maintained by Meta, Django by the Django Software Foundation, and Next.js by Vercel with strong community backing. Free and open-source does not mean unreliable. In web development, it usually means battle-tested by thousands of production deployments.
Q4. How do AI-assisted frameworks improve development efficiency?
AI coding tools like GitHub Copilot and Cursor generate significantly better suggestions in well-typed, convention-heavy frameworks because they have more context about what you are trying to build. A Next.js project with TypeScript and tRPC gives AI tools complete type information across the full stack resulting in accurate completions rather than generic guesses. Teams using AI assistance in typed framework projects consistently report 20 to 40 percent faster feature development on routine tasks.
Q5. What features should I prioritize when choosing a web development framework?
Prioritize in this order, fit for your project type first, community and documentation second, scalability third, and ecosystem compatibility fourth. A technically superior framework with poor documentation will slow your team down more than a slightly less optimal framework with excellent learning resources. Never choose purely on benchmark performance or GitHub stars, always validate against your specific use case.